easyexcel怎么设置全局配置表框线条,不针对单个单元格?
时间: 2024-11-15 10:28:28 浏览: 15
easyexcel合并单元格
EasyExcel 是阿里巴巴开源的一个 Excel 读写工具,它主要用来处理大数据量的 Excel 文件,而不是直接操作单元格的样式。然而,你可以通过 EasyExcel 的全局配置来设置导出 Excel 的样式,包括表框线条等外观属性。
要设置全局的表格样式,你可以在读取 Excel 或写入 Excel 的时候,使用 `SheetBuilder` 类的 `build()` 方法,传递一个自定义的 `Style` 对象,这个对象包含了你需要的样式设置。例如,如果你想要设置默认的表格线样式,可以这样操作[^1]:
```java
// 创建一个 Style 对象并设置边框样式
Style style = new DefaultStyle();
style.setBorderBottom(BorderType.THIN); // 设置底部边框为细线
// 使用 EasyExcel 写入 Excel 时,指定该样式
Workbook excel = ExcelWriter.builder(new File("output.xlsx"))
.registerListener(EasyExcelWriterListener.create())
.sheet("Sheet1")
.doWrite(dataList, style) // dataList 是你要写入的数据
.finish();
```
请注意,这并不会直接影响到每个单元格的样式,而是为整个工作簿或某个特定的工作表设置了默认样式。如果后续在写入过程中不需要更改样式,那么所有单元格都将继承这个设定。
阅读全文